The Crucial T700 2TB wins in 5 out of 7 comparable specs, with 1 tie. Its biggest advantage is Sequential Write (181% better).
P3 Plus 2TB wins in 1 spec (MSRP: 69% better).
Recommendation
Choose T700 2TB if you want the best overall performance — especially sequential write.
Choose P3 Plus 2TB if msrp matters more to you.
